Dancing Nuns Go Viral Dancing To Help ‘Cheer People Up’

You don’t often hear about Catholic nuns these days, but occasionally they make headlines. Recently, the Soli Sisters from Ontario, Canada, gained attention online.

These nuns play a significant role in educating people about the Catholic faith and are actively involved in supporting the elderly. Recently, they decided to uplift spirits by participating in a unique dance challenge.

It’s truly inspiring when individuals take the initiative to help others, especially when they have the chance. In this instance, they joined the ‘Jerusalema Challenge,’ which was destined to go viral.

It was unexpected to see members of the Catholic Church, representing a global community, come together to create something both humorous and brilliant. Their efforts made a noticeable impact, showcasing the difference they can make.

In addition to sharing their faith, these nuns embraced a popular dance trend, learning the moves to join in the fun. They practiced and then shared their performance on YouTube.

This dance trend originated in 2019 when South African artist Master KG released the song “Jerusalema” on YouTube. It quickly gained popularity, sparking a worldwide dance phenomenon.

While many have participated in this dance craze, the nuns truly stood out. You can witness their delightful and entertaining performance in the video.
